Hi all, firstly apologies if I am posting on the wrong board, if so please point me to where I might be able to get help.

I am running multiple sequences programmed on Xlights on the Falcon player/Raspi. The lights are in a live venue and we would like to be able to change sequences on the Falcon player without having to blackout the current sequence. Is there any way to fade sequences together gently rather than having to totally purge the previous sequence / blackout before activating the new selected sequence?

Thanks for any advice in advance :)
P

CaptainMurdoch

There is no automatic fading ability between sequences, but if you are driving this externally, you could use FPP Commands to initiate a fade out, start the new sequence, then initiate a fade in.  This would be done using the brightness command.
